Data Reconciliation Specialist

Our client is looking for a Data Reconciliation Specialist. This is a long-term contract role, where you'll play a pivotal part in ensuring the accuracy and integrity of financial and trading data while contributing to process improvements. If you have a passion for data analysis, thrive in spreadsheets, and enjoy refining workflows, this is an excellent opportunity to make a meaningful impact. Responsibilities: Reconcile data across multiple platforms, including databases, Google Sheets, Snowflake, and Looker, ensuring consistency and accuracy. Review financial transactions, categorize them appropriately, and verify compliance with reporting standards. Validate trade records by cross-referencing payments data, transaction IDs, and blotter tools to maintain operational accuracy. Conduct quality assurance checks to confirm dataset integrity and identify discrepancies. Analyze the current reconciliation processes to seamlessly integrate and identify opportunities for improvement. Develop new QA protocols to flag errors or discrepancies proactively during daily reconciliations. Collaborate on refining and restructuring reconciliation workflows to enhance efficiency and scalability. Take ownership of reconciliation processes, ensuring they are performed accurately and on schedule. Contribute to innovative solutions for process enhancement and automation where applicable. Requirements: Proven experience in data reconciliation and proficiency with tools such as pivot tables and Google Sheets. Exceptional attention to detail and a systematic approach to validating large datasets. Strong analytical skills and a passion for optimizing workflows and processes. Familiarity with Microsoft SQL and BusinessObjects Technologies. Knowledge of data analysis and business intelligence (BI) tools. Experience with Erwin Data modeling tools. Hands-on expertise with Snowflake and Looker is a plus. Basic programming knowledge in Python for automation or scripting tasks is desirable.
